Named Executive Officers, Footnote     Robert M. Patterson was our principal executive officer (“First PEO”) for the full year for each of 2022, 2021 and 2020. For 2023, Mr. Patterson was our First PEO from January 1 - December 1. Dr. Ashish Khandpur was our principal executive officer ("Second PEO") from December 1, 2023 - December 31, 2023. For 2023, 2022 and 2021, our non-PEO named executive officers were Jamie A. Beggs, Michael A. Garratt, Lisa K. Kunkle, and Joel R. Rathbun. For 2020, our non-PEO named executive officers were Jamie A. Beggs, Michael A. Garratt, M. John Midea, Lisa K. Kunkle, and Bradley C. Richardson.      
Peer Group Issuers, Footnote     For purposes of this pay versus performance disclosure, our peer group is the S&P 400 Chemicals index (the "Peer Group"). For each Covered Year, our peer group cumulative total shareholder return was calculated based on a deemed fixed investment of $100 through the Measurement Period, assuming dividend reinvestment.

Compensation Actually Paid vs. Net Income    
Net Income versus Compensation Actually Paid
NET_4.7B.jpg
First PEOSecond PEOAverage Non-PEO Named Executive OfficerNet Income
Net Income versus Compensation Actually Paid. Net income includes the income from discontinued operations, and for 2022 includes a one time $550 million gain on the sale of our Distribution business. Therefore, in 2022, net income is not heavily correlated with named executive officer compensation because this gain is not reflective of the underlying performance of the Company.

Additional 402(v) Disclosure     For each Covered Year, our total shareholder return was calculated as the yearly percentage change in our cumulative total shareholder return on our common stock, par value $0.01 per share, measured as the quotient of (a) the sum of (i) the cumulative amount of dividends for a period beginning with our closing price on the New York Stock Exchange (“NYSE”) on December 31, 2019 through and including the last day of the Covered Year (each one-year, two-year, three-year, and four-year period, a “Measurement Period”), assuming dividend reinvestment, plus (ii) the difference between our closing stock price at the end versus the beginning of the Measurement Period, divided by (b) our closing share price at the beginning of the Measurement Period. Each of these yearly percentage changes was then applied to a deemed fixed investment of $100 at the beginning of the Measurement Period to produce the Covered Year-end values of such investment as of the end of 2023, 2022, 2021 and 2020, as applicable. Because Covered Years are presented in the table in reverse chronical order (from top to bottom), the table should be read from bottom to top for purposes of understanding cumulative returns over time.
